svn merge -r36583:36603 https://svn.blender.org/svnroot/bf-blender/trunk/blender
[blender.git] / source / blender / editors / curve / editcurve.c
index 01a39cf208c84d135b2afcc3943fa5d55272b03a..4606b443e65cc13b0576ea307158fee1b7462de2 100644 (file)
@@ -6558,12 +6558,12 @@ static int curvesurf_prim_add(bContext *C, wmOperator *op, int type, int isSurf)
        ListBase *editnurb;
        Nurb *nu;
        int newob= 0;
-       int enter_editmode;
+       int enter_editmode, is_aligned;
        unsigned int layer;
        float loc[3], rot[3];
        float mat[4][4];
 
-       if(!ED_object_add_generic_get_opts(C, op, loc, rot, &enter_editmode, &layer))
+       if(!ED_object_add_generic_get_opts(C, op, loc, rot, &enter_editmode, &layer, &is_aligned))
                return OPERATOR_CANCELLED;
 
        if (!isSurf) { /* adding curve */
@@ -6956,7 +6956,7 @@ static void *undo_check_lastsel(void *lastsel, Nurb *nu, Nurb *newnu)
        return NULL;
 }
 
-static void undoCurve_to_editCurve(void *ucu, void *obe)
+static void undoCurve_to_editCurve(void *ucu, void *UNUSED(edata), void *obe)
 {
        Object *obedit= obe;
        Curve *cu= (Curve*)obedit->data;
@@ -7006,7 +7006,7 @@ static void undoCurve_to_editCurve(void *ucu, void *obe)
        ED_curve_updateAnimPaths(obedit);
 }
 
-static void *editCurve_to_undoCurve(void *obe)
+static void *editCurve_to_undoCurve(void *UNUSED(edata), void *obe)
 {
        Object *obedit= obe;
        Curve *cu= (Curve*)obedit->data;